The co-pilot and lone survivor of the Comair jet crash in Lexington, Kentucky wants to fly again. Apparently, he is using the potential return to the cockpit as motivation in his rehabilitation. All other 49 people onboard the flight were killed. The cause? As in most aviation disasters, a series of avoidable errors, leading to an attempted takeoff from the wrong runway.

Last weekend was a sad weekend for the families of five men who were killed in a plane crash 17 miles off shore from Fort Lauderdale. After taking off at 8:57 a.m. on Saturday, the 1965 Piper Aztec leveled off at 4,500 feet. It was immediately engulfed in stormy conditions and flew into the area of a "level 4" thunderstorm, likely containing severe turbulence, the report said. In little more...
